Dressing like Olive Garden

1/2 cup white wine vinegar
1/3 cup water
1/3 cup vegetable oil
1/4 cup corn syrup
2 1/2 Tlbs Romano cheese, grated
2 Tlbs dry pectin (Sure Jell - the cold set type)
2 Tlbs egg
1 tsp salt
1 tsp lemon juice
1/2 tsp minced garlic
2 tsp fresh parsley or 1/2 tsp dried
pinch of dried oregano
pinch of crushed red pepper

Whizz it all up with a blender and chill for at least an hour. Makes about 2 cups. Because of the egg, it doesn't have a long storage life.

The salad

Mixed lettuce (leaf, radicchio, romaine) or use a bag of Italian mix
sliced red onion
pitted black olives, whole
pickled pepperoncini, whole
garlic croutons
tomato, cut in wedges

Add the dressing to taste, top with grated Parm & ground black pepper.
